This one-day tour is the perfect excursion for guests looking for a fascinating day in the beautiful countryside along the banks of the river Loire. You will enjoy the lively atmosphere of a colourful market (Wednesdays & Sundays) and also discover the delicious goat's cheeses that contribute to the fame of the region. You can visit the historic riverside town of la Charité-sur-Loire and its famous 12C Benedictine priory. Furthermore, the tour will take you to the historic hilltop town of Sancerre and is the perfect introduction to the world-class Sauvignon blanc wines of the Central Loire Valley. You will also discover the vineyards of Pouilly-sur-Loire where a visit to a local wine maker will be your opportunity to taste and learn all about another household name in Sauvignon blanc wines, the wonderful Pouilly Fumé. And red wine lovers, please do not despair, the region also producers some great pinots, especially from around Sancerre.

Discover the Sancerre & Pouilly Fumé wine region, dominated by Sauvignon Blanc grapes where the white wines of the region tend to be structured with acidity & citrus with mineral and herbal aromatics.
